Outdoor Amphitheaters and Park ConcertsOne of the easiest ways to experience live music with children while traveling is by seeking out local outdoor amphitheaters and community park concert series. Many major cities and tourist destinations host free or low-cost summer music series in public squares, botanical gardens, and beachfronts. These venues are ideal for families because they eliminate the rigid constraints of traditional indoor concert halls. Children can dance on the grass, enjoy a picnic dinner, and move around freely without the fear of disturbing other patrons. From jazz in the park to local indie bands, these casual settings allow travelers to mingle with locals and absorb the authentic vibe of the destination in a relaxed, open-air environment.

All-Ages Music FestivalsMusic festivals are no longer exclusive to young adults and backpackers. A growing global trend has seen the rise of highly organized, family-centric music festivals that cater explicitly to multi-generational travelers. These events feature dedicated kids’ zones, interactive instrument workshops, creative arts and crafts, and early-evening headliner sets so little ones can get to bed on time. Festivals celebrating folk, bluegrass, and world music are particularly well-suited for families, offering a laid-back atmosphere, diverse food trucks, and a safe, enclosed environment where everyone can explore different genres of music together.

Matinee Theater and Musical RevuesWhen traveling to major cultural hubs like New York City, London, or Sydney, catching a matinee performance is a spectacular way to introduce children to high-caliber live music. Many theatrical productions and musical revues offer afternoon showtimes that align perfectly with a child’s energy levels. Opting for jukebox musicals, Disney theatrical productions, or lively historical revues ensures that the music is recognizable, upbeat, and visually engaging. Matinee audiences often include many other families, creating a welcoming and forgiving atmosphere where the collective excitement enhances the overall experience.

Hotel and Resort Live EntertainmentFor travelers seeking maximum convenience, selecting accommodations that feature built-in live entertainment is a fantastic strategy. Many family-friendly resorts, cruise ships, and holiday ranches curate specialized evening entertainment lineups that require zero travel time. From poolside steel drum bands during the afternoon to family karaoke nights and acoustic campfire sing-alongs under the stars, these hyper-local performances keep the vacation energy high without the stress of navigating an unfamiliar city at night. It allows parents to relax with a drink while children enjoy safe, supervised entertainment just steps away from their hotel room.

Culturally Immersive Dinner ShowsCombining local cuisine with traditional live music is an efficient and deeply rewarding way to experience a new culture. Many destinations around the world offer family-friendly dinner shows that showcase regional sounds, traditional instruments, and vibrant storytelling. Whether it is a traditional Luau in Hawaii, a lively Mariachi performance in Mexico, or a Celtic music and dance feast in Ireland, these events engage all the senses. The structured nature of a dinner show keeps children occupied with food while the energetic, rhythmic music and colorful costumes hold their attention from start to finish.
